Output 6158cd3625ef39520f5eff40146e178177a847cc8a4754014fefffa26b86cc20:0

value
1061088
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 461bb65b75adab5330a213e797a8571a644ebcde OP_EQUALVERIFY OP_CHECKSIG
address
17PhVv4Ls8YFahZRt42YmrETiN62tYT7xb
transaction
6158cd3625ef39520f5eff40146e178177a847cc8a4754014fefffa26b86cc20
confirmations
470095
spent
true